Team may play bowl game
The Manville Colts lost the first round of the playoffs to Kenilworth 14-6. This week’s captains were Altaron Robinson, Andre Heredia, Joey Veglatte, LJ Abner and Matias Gualtieri.
The offense was slow to get going both inside and outside the ends. Kenilworth came prepared for the Colts’ outside attack and the yards inside were tough to get.
Heredia, the team’s quarterback, finally saw an opportunity to sneak the ball, once for a big first down and the second time for a 31-yard gain to Kenilworth’s 2-yard line. On the next play, Robinson scored and the Colts led 6-0. The extra point attempt failed and the Colts had a 6-0 lead at the half.
A couple of Colt fumbles ended drives in the second half. Carrying the ball for the Colts was Gualtieri for 50 yards, Robinson for 30 yards and Heredia for 34 yards. Isiah Morgan made a big pass reception of 30 yards from Veglatte.
The offensive line worked hard to stop Kenilworth’s penetration. Jonathan Rizk, Mike Salvatore, Jake Babich, Marc Hagin, Jake Caswell, Nick Harenza, Angelo Locham, Sergio Mora, Darnell, Arber Berisha and Ariel Rodriguez all participated on the offensive line.
The defense had a bright spot with a fumble recovery by Mergum Berisha. Leading in tackles was Veglatte with eight, followed by Caswell and Gualtieri with five apiece. Babich also had four tackles and outside linebackers Abner and Robinson each added three.
Also seeing a little time on the defense were Ariel Rodriguez, Darnell, Harenza, Salvatore and Arber Berisha. Other starters that contributed were Hagin, Heredia and Rizk.
Over the next week, the Colts will contemplate whether or not to participate in a bowl game.
